93 FD w/3 rotor : How much is it worth?

How much would you pay for this FD with a 3 rotor motor? Mods include:

Black w/ tan interior ; 62,000 miles Conversion started at 49,000 miles

New 3 rotor engine, all parts new to include: 3- new rotor housings 4 side housings (all from Mazda Comp)

Extra dowel pinning for strength

3mm apex seals w/ dual springs

3 - 850cc secondary injectors

Hi-Performance silicon O rings

10mm Magnecor plug wires

Light- aluminum flywheel ACT pressure plate

Stainless steel 3" down pipe Stainless steel mid-pipe w/ resonator

Racing Beat limited muffler w/ 5 ¼ tip

10"x20"x3.5" custom Spearco Inter-cooler

Custom aluminum radiator

Greddy Type S BOV

Spall dual electric fans

Microtech MTX-12 ECU w/dash display

20B fuel pump

Racing Hart C5 5 spoke wheels 17x8 frt / 17x9 rear w/ Kuhmo tires

Racing Beat springs

GAB Super R 8-way adj. Struts

Blitz Boost controller

Greddy turbo timer & EGT

Autometer boost & air/fuel gages

SPA fuel pressure & water temp gage

RX-7 R-1 front spoiler

After market rear spoiler

Mazda rear hatch sunshade

1999 RX-7 spec round rear tail lights

New upper & lower control arm bushings

Hi-Performance stainless rear link set

RX-7 R-1 2nd oil cooler

Greddy pulley set

RC Engineering Big bore throttle body

Stainless steel braided oil cooler lines

After market Blaupunkt / Alpine stereo system w/ 10" sub

5th gear hub and syncro replaced - 49K miles
